The Japanese designer, ISSEY MIYAKe is proud to announce the opening of its first flagship boutique in Italy, Milan, in the heart of Palazzo Reina, a historic building in the Quadrilatero area, Via Bagutta 12. Spread over the main floors of the Palazzo, with a surface area of ​​approximately 500m2, this is the first time that an ISSEY MIYAKE boutique has been established in an historic building.

 

“Design is an act of discovery, making things, making reality, freedom, innovation.
Design is work that brings people joy. For me Milano is already the city of all creativity. I am proud to be part of it. ” -Issey Miyake

Tokujin Yoshioka was in charge of the interior design of the shop.

“A unique aesthetic is created when the historical landscape of the city meets the futuristic interior panels by expressing the passage of time. What attracts us is a past enriched as much as the layers of history by an opaque and undeveloped future. The boutique is housed in a 19th century building a location near Via Montenapoleone, which is famous for its historic architecture and symbol of refinement. This contrast between past and future is found in the juxtaposition of colored aluminum and the age of the walls. Floating sculptures in rounded aluminum are colored like pieces of tinted fabrics. Blue, orange and green symbolize the energy of nature, while playing on the translucent aspect. The essence of design in harmony with technology and craftsmanship is projected through the shop’s space, reflecting the philosophy of Issey Miyake’s creations. ” – Tokujin Yoshioka
